Default Awfercrissake!....No reverse on the A-car! Is it done for? Any help appreciated!

No warning lights are on. Car will move slowly in reverse as if the clutch pack is slipping. Forward gears are all fine. Did not check for codes yet. STFA and found this is a somewhat common failure mode. Has anyone had a positive outcome with this short of a full rebuild?

Default Re: F seal I believe

The very "end" of the transmission has he reverse gearset and there is a seal that wears out.

Supposedly you could buy the F seal part, take off the transmission, and replace just that part. Not sure if that is the best option however.

Default Unfortunately we see it more and more on the 01' A/S8 and A6 4.2

The F piston that engages reverse and 2nd to 1st downshift blows. You have to completely disassemble the tranny to replace the F piston.
